I am currently in the Air Canada Lounge awaiting departure. No problems with anything so far. At check-in there was a friendly lady who did not even mention the fare and gave us directions to the lounge without us even having to ask. The lounge was almost empty until just a few minutes ago. Free WiFi or computers with internet access available. Salad, soup, cookies, general munchies available along with usual wine, alcohol and other beverages. Overall very pleasant place to await a flight.
